WitrynaNeutrons have zero electrical charges and cannot directly cause ionization. Neutrons ionize matter only indirectly. For example, when neutrons strike the hydrogen nuclei, proton radiation (fast protons) results. This reaction is known as scattering. Neutrons can also be absorbed. Witryna29 lip 2024 · Unlike protons, the number of neutrons is not absolutely fixed for most elements. Atoms that have the same number of protons, and hence the same atomic number, but different numbers of neutrons are called isotopes All isotopes of an element have the same number of protons and electrons, which means they exhibit the same …

WitrynaNeutrons represent a major category of radiation that consists of uncharged particles. Owing to the absence of the Coulomb force, neutrons may penetrate many centimetres through solid materials before they interact in any manner. When they do interact, it is primarily with the nuclei of atoms of the absorbing material. Witryna[en] The discovery of the neutron by J. Chadwick in 1932 was a milestone in the development of nuclear physics and technology. Apart from basic findings on the structure of atomic nuclei, this discovery has found various fields of application among which nuclear power technology is the most important.
